Hello I was looking for some information on Douglas, MA from people who live there or have lived there before. I'm considering relocating to the area and was wondering what people thought of it, I like the rural setting of the community and I also have young children that would be attending the schools, I have heard bad things about neighboring towns like Webster and was wondering what the atmosphere was like in Douglas and of course honest opinions about the school system..Thanks for any help I appreciate it..
Douglas is a mostly rural town, nothing at all like Webster. Never lived there but know a couple of families there and are very happy where they are and with the schools.
Douglas has grown a lot over the last 20 years, mainly because it still appears rural despite being in a great location. It's just 5 minutes from Route 146, and you can be in Worcester and Providence in 20+ minutes. It's schools are decent and crime is very low. The real estate stock is good because much of it is still fairly new. It's grown a lot compared to other towns. In 1980, it had just over 3,700 people, and in the 2000s, it was over 8,000 and counting. Another plus is that it has it's own high school, so your kids won't have to be bussed 30 minutes to another town. Have lived in this town for over thirty years and raised a family. There are pluses and minuses and always town issues. The school system is made up of a k - 12 and is a member of a vocational school system (blackstone valley tech) that eigth graders can apply for. While taxes may take a hit in the next few years, the Town, is building a new middle school as well as a multi million dollar renevation to the elementary school. The faculty at all schools are exceptional. Due to the small size of the school there are a number of scholastic and athletic programs. Douglas is known for it's award winning bands that have won numerous trophies and awards. Todate, no taxpayers have been charged a fee for bussing.
